Output d8eeecfc714e2aeaaef29526450b120001fd7b45f1a830b14708e19e4e46039b:0

value
71799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d8df17d679c60f8ffd2cf32359833bfb157097f OP_EQUAL
address
3BgHcr91shyh7xWzMT9KGef4e3PgVt2nxm
transaction
d8eeecfc714e2aeaaef29526450b120001fd7b45f1a830b14708e19e4e46039b
confirmations
165349
spent
true